The Channel Gate Market size was valued at USD 1.5 Billion in 2022 and is projected to reach USD 2.5 Billion by 2030, growing at a CAGR of 7.5% from 2024 to 2030.

In subway systems, Channel Gates are essential for providing controlled access to platforms and preventing unauthorized entry into restricted areas. The integration of these gates within subway stations helps regulate passenger flow, ensuring smooth operations and a safer commuting experience. They are often equipped with advanced security features, such as biometric scanning or RFID technology, which enables efficient ticketing and access control. As urban populations continue to grow, the need for more sophisticated, automated systems within public transit infrastructure increases, driving the demand for Channel Gates in subway systems worldwide.
Furthermore, the installation of Channel Gates in subway stations is directly tied to the development of smarter, more efficient transit networks. These gates help in managing the large volume of daily commuters while maintaining safety protocols. By reducing human intervention, Channel Gates ensure quicker entry and exit times, contributing to overall operational efficiency. Additionally, the growing emphasis on contactless payment systems and digital ticketing within public transportation networks further promotes the adoption of advanced Channel Gate solutions in subway systems. The result is a more streamlined, user-friendly travel experience, enhancing the convenience for commuters while strengthening security measures.

In libraries, Channel Gates are becoming an increasingly popular solution to manage access to books and other resources, as well as ensure that library materials are properly protected. These gates help prevent theft, maintain security, and control the flow of people within different sections of the library. By offering a seamless and automated way to monitor entrances and exits, Channel Gates help create a more organized and efficient library environment. Patrons can enter or exit with ease, while the system ensures that borrowed materials are accounted for, providing enhanced service to both visitors and library staff.
The implementation of Channel Gates in libraries has also made it easier for libraries to implement more sophisticated asset tracking systems. Libraries can now incorporate RFID technology, which enables the easy monitoring and management of books and other materials. This not only enhances the security of library collections but also improves the overall visitor experience by minimizing wait times and reducing the need for manual intervention. The growing trend towards digitalization in libraries is further driving the adoption of Channel Gates as part of a broader shift toward automated solutions in the public sector. This trend is likely to continue as libraries strive for greater efficiency and security in their operations.

1. What are Channel Gates used for?
Channel Gates are used to regulate access to specific areas, ensuring security and controlling the flow of people, especially in high-traffic environments like subways, train stations, and libraries.
2. How do Channel Gates improve security?
By limiting access to only authorized individuals, Channel Gates enhance security by preventing unauthorized entry and theft in sensitive areas.
3. What technologies are integrated into Channel Gates?
Channel Gates can integrate technologies like RFID, biometric authentication, and smart ticketing for efficient and secure access control.
4. What industries use Channel Gates?
Channel Gates are used in public transportation, libraries, airports, shopping malls, stadiums, and various other commercial and governmental sectors.
5. How do Channel Gates enhance operational efficiency?
By automating access control, Channel Gates reduce the need for manual monitoring, improve crowd management, and increase throughput in high-traffic areas.
